Pronunciation

Each Play button uses your device's default local English voice, or a natural local fallback. The selected voice name appears after playback. This is synthesized speech, not a source recording.

  • Received-Pronunciation: /ɔːˈɡænɪkli/
  • Southern-England: Recorded audio is listed in the source snapshot.
  • Canada, General-American: /oɹˈɡænɪkli/
  • Canada, General-American: [oɹˈɡɛənɪkli] /æ/ raising
  • Australian: /oːˈɡænɪkli/
  • New-Zealand: /oːˈɡɛnəkli/
  • CMU ARPABET: AO0 R G AE1 N IH0 K L IY0 Digits mark lexical stress: 1 primary, 2 secondary, 0 unstressed.

1

adv

Meaning 1

In an organic manner.

7

adverb

Meaning 7

involving carbon compounds

Definition source: Princeton WordNet 3.0

Examples

  • organically bound iodine

8

adverb

Meaning 8

as an important constituent

Definition source: Princeton WordNet 3.0

Examples

  • the drapery served organically to cover the Madonna
